2121 Ala Wai is a 40-story condominium building located in the vibrant Waikiki neighborhood of Honolulu, Oahu. Completed in 1979, this high-rise features 212 units and offers residents a blend of modern convenience and island charm. The building's location provides easy access to the best of Waikiki, including its famous beaches, shopping centers, and dining options.
Spacious units with stunning views
The units at 2121 Ala Wai range from 653 to 1,360 square feet, all featuring 2 bedrooms and 1 to 3 bathrooms. Prices for these units range from $459,000 to $650,000. Each unit is designed to maximize space and comfort, with large lanais offering breathtaking views of the Ala Wai Canal, Diamond Head, and the surrounding mountains. Many units have been recently renovated to include modern amenities such as plantation shutters, travertine-tiled bathrooms, and granite kitchen countertops. Some units also feature high-end appliances like Bosch and KitchenAid, as well as custom cabinetry and fixtures. The open floor plans and large windows allow for plenty of natural light and cooling trade winds, making air conditioning unnecessary for most residents.
Comprehensive amenities for a comfortable lifestyle
Residents of 2121 Ala Wai enjoy a wide range of amenities designed to enhance their living experience. The building features a community pool, sauna, BBQ area, recreation room, sundeck, and a party room. There is also a large lobby, meeting room, and a car wash area. For added convenience, the building offers guest parking, secured parking, and three elevators. Security is a top priority, with 24/7 security, a resident manager, and a security guard on-site. The building also allows service and emotional support animals, ensuring a welcoming environment for all residents.
Vibrant Waikiki neighborhood
Waikiki is a bustling neighborhood known for its rich history and modern attractions. Once a vacation retreat for Hawaiian royalty, Waikiki now attracts millions of tourists each year. The area is home to iconic landmarks like the Royal Hawaiian Hotel and the Duke Kahanamoku surfing memorial. Waikiki Beach, considered the birthplace of modern surfing, is just a short walk from 2121 Ala Wai. The neighborhood offers a variety of dining options, from upscale restaurants with ocean views to casual eateries like Musubi Cafe IYASUME and Pit Stop Tacos Burgers & Sliders. Shopping enthusiasts will appreciate the proximity to the International Marketplace and the Royal Hawaiian Shopping Center. For outdoor activities, residents can visit nearby parks such as Kapi’olani Regional Park and the Ala Wai Golf Course.
Convenient transportation options
2121 Ala Wai is well-connected to various transportation options, making it easy for residents to navigate the area. Several bus stops are within a five-minute walk, including Kuhio Ave & Launiu St, Kuhio Ave & Lewers St, and Saratoga Rd & Kalakaua Ave. These stops provide access to multiple transit lines, including routes to Ala Moana, Sea Life Park, and the airport. For those who prefer to drive, the building offers secured parking and is close to major roads like Ala Moana Boulevard and the H1 Interstate. The Daniel K. Inouye International Airport is approximately 20 minutes away by car, providing convenient access for travelers.
